#EEDBBC Hex color

#EEDBBC

The hexadecimal color code #EEDBBC corresponds to the code RGB( 238, 219, 188 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,86 level) and blue (at 0,74 level). Its brightness is 83% and its saturation is 59%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 33% and blue at 29%.
